Minnetonka Cannabis Laws
Minnetonka Cannabis Ordinance
Minnetonka has adopted cannabis zoning regulations consistent with Minnesota state law and OCM licensing requirements. Public consumption is prohibited throughout the city under state law, including in city parks, along Lake Minnetonka, and all other public spaces. Minnetonka does not add restrictions beyond state statutes.
Home Grow Rules in Minnetonka
Minnesota law allows adults 21 and older to grow up to 8 cannabis plants at home, with a maximum of 4 mature plants at any time. Plants must be in an enclosed locked space not visible from public view. Minnetonka does not add local restrictions. Review your HOA rules and lease before cultivating.
Purchase and Possession Limits
- Up to 2 ounces of cannabis flower per transaction
- Up to 8 grams of concentrate
- Edibles: up to 800mg THC per transaction
- Public possession: 2 ounces; home possession: 2 pounds
Medical Cannabis
Minnetonka residents can enroll in Minnesota's medical cannabis program at mn.gov/ocm at no cost. Your OCM patient ID saves roughly 22% at any licensed dispensary. The nearest dispensaries accepting medical cards are in Minneapolis.
